
Itinéraire de 3 jours à Xiamen + Gulangyu 2026 : ville côtière et île aux pianos
Trois jours à Xiamen couvrent l'île de Gulangyu (1 journée complète), la vieille ville + le temple Nanputuo, et une excursion d'une journée aux Tulou du Fujian. Sans visa pendant 30 jours. Vol vers Xiamen Gaoqi (XMN) ou HSR depuis Shanghai (4-5h).

BEFORE YOU GO
Practical Tips for this trip
A handful of things our editors flag for every China itinerary — sorted from 'must do' to 'nice to know'.
Visa and entry documents
Most Western passports get 30-day visa-free entry in 2026. Bring your passport (6+ months validity), a printed hotel reservation, and the return ticket — border agents occasionally ask.
Payment setup
Set up Alipay or WeChat Pay before you fly and link a Visa or Mastercard. Cash still works at small shops but mobile pay is the default almost everywhere.
Connectivity
Order a China eSIM (Airalo, Holafly, China Unicom) before departure — the visa-free visitors' data plans are now widely supported and cost under $10 for 5 GB.

BUDGET
Budget Breakdown
Per-person totals across the whole trip, in USD. Backpacker assumes hostel + metro; mid-range assumes 3-star hotel + a taxi day; luxury assumes 5-star hotel + private driver. Figures assume a 3-day trip.
| Line item | Backpacker | Mid-range | Luxury |
|---|---|---|---|
| Accommodation | $121 | $264 | $660+ |
| Food | $44 | $96 | $216+ |
| Transport | $22 | $58 | $120+ |
| Attractions | $22 | $38 | $84+ |
| SIM / data | $10 | $15 | $25+ |
| Visa | $0 | $0 | $0+ |
| Misc | $20 | $40 | $120+ |
| TOTAL | $239 | $511 | $1225+ |
USD per person, across the whole trip. Excludes international flights. Last verified Q3 2026.
